Abstract
Significance: Trichotillomania (TTM), characterized by repeated pulling of one’s hair to the
point of hair loss or thinning, produces impairment in physical, social, psychological and
occupational functioning. Empirically supported treatment options for those with TTM are
seriously limited. Among treatments shown to be effective is behavior therapy. Unfortunately,
behavior therapy is limited in that developing real-time awareness of pulling remains
challenging, there is a lack of widespread availability, and it typically has high cost.
Hypothesis: It is hypothesized that a novel wrist-worn device and app system can be used to
deliver Habit Reversal Therapy, a key component of behavior therapy, for trichotillomania. The
device, using sophisticated motion sensors and algorithms, can be trained to detect an
individual’s pulling behavior and thus augment awareness in real-time. Further, it can detect a
competing response and build motivation via a user-friendly, feature rich mobile application.
Preliminary Data: The investigative team’s device can record and detect a motion and
orientation, representative of hair pulling behavior, reliably, per machine testing. Additionally, in
one individual, a behavior of playing with eyebrows was reliably detected in >90% of cases with
an acceptable rate (30%) of false positives for similar behaviors.
Specific Aim 1: The ability of the device to accurately detect TTM-related behavior will be
established and validated. The team will (1) catalog and record the range of motions that go into
TTM-related pulling, and (2) refine and test the capacity of the device to accurately detect the
motions in both simulated and human tests
Specific Aim 2: Develop the HabitAware device and accompanying app as a stand-alone
system for delivering self-administered HRT, utilizing an iterative process informed by expert
end-user clinicians and persons with TTM.
Specific Aim 3: The team will conduct an initial feasibility, usability and acceptability test of the
HabitAware device to determine next steps and progress to a Phase II proposal.
Long-Term Goal: We aim to develop a user-friendly, widely accessible and affordable system
that helps treat trichotillomania via a device that provides real-time awareness of pulling
behavior and a mobile app that incorporates elements of existing behavior therapy protocols.
